Plot Summary

Set in a hyper-modern Brooklyn high school, Grand Army follows five teenagers from different walks of life as they navigate the overwhelming pressures of adolescence. The series delves into their struggles with identity, sexuality, social hierarchies, and the emotional turmoil of growing up in a complex urban environment. Each episode focuses on a different student, revealing their personal battles and their attempts to find their place in the world.

Critical Reception

Grand Army received mixed to positive reviews, with critics often praising its ambitious scope and authentic portrayal of teenage life, while some found its handling of sensitive topics uneven. The performances of the young cast were frequently highlighted as a major strength.

What Reviewers Say

  • Praised for its authentic depiction of contemporary teen issues and strong performances from its young ensemble.
  • Noted for its ambitious storytelling approach, tackling complex social and emotional themes.
  • Some critics found the series' exploration of sensitive subjects to be occasionally heavy-handed or uneven.

Google audience: Audiences generally appreciated the show's realistic portrayal of high school challenges and the relatable struggles of the characters. Many viewers found the performances compelling and the series thought-provoking, although some felt certain storylines could have been developed further.
